HOW AN AGENT WORKS
Every agent follows a controlled migration loop.
Agents do not simply generate an answer and move on. They work from migration context, validate their outputs, expose uncertainty, route exceptions, and preserve approved decisions for downstream work.
01
CONTEXT
Read what is already known — schemas, rules, dependencies and prior approvals.
02
REASON
Interpret the migration task against source semantics, target expectations and relevant constraints.
03
GENERATE
Create the migration output — a mapping, a translation, a test, or reconciliation logic.
04
VALIDATE
Check before accepting, using deterministic rules, execution results and source-target comparison.
05
SCORE
Make uncertainty visible. Every output carries a confidence signal.
06
REVIEW
Route exceptions to the right expert. Low-confidence or unusual outputs stop for review.
07
REMEMBER
Preserve approved outcomes. Approved decisions become context for downstream agents.
LOOPS BACK INTO 01 · CONTEXT

CONTROL & REVIEW
Automate what is repeatable. Escalate what isn’t.
Not every migration decision should be automated. Datachecks separates routine execution from uncertainty, exceptions, and business-critical judgment.
AUTO-EXECUTE
HIGH CONFIDENCE
Profiling · Metadata analysis · High-confidence mappings · Standard translations · Test generation · Row counts · Aggregate comparisons
UNCERTAINTY SURFACED
REVIEW
EXPERT REVIEW
Ambiguous mappings · Low-confidence transformation logic · Unsupported syntax · Unexpected data patterns · Reconciliation discrepancies
BUSINESS-CRITICAL
HUMAN-OWNED
HUMAN DECISION
Business-rule interpretation · Critical exception resolution · Migration scope decisions · Acceptance criteria · Cutover approval
